  • Opportunity to work within a specialized and growing industry About the Industry The commercial door and hardware industry is a specialized field within commercial construction involving doors, frames, hardware, life safety systems, and building security components used in schools, hospitals, airports, government buildings, offices, and other large-scale facilities.
Experienced professionals in this industry are highly valued and often enjoy long-term career stability due to the technical nature of the work and the ongoing nationwide demand for qualified individuals.
